SignApp Introduces DSSHOW Digital Signage Software
SignApp GmbH & Co. KG has released its DSSHOW software, enabling the display of diverse content, including news feeds and social media updates, on digital signage screens.

German company SignApp GmbH & Co. KG has launched DSSHOW, a digital signage software solution aimed at businesses seeking to display real-time information and social media content. The software allows for dynamic content management on public-facing screens.
DSSHOW provides direct integration capabilities with various live data sources. This includes the ability to incorporate RSS feeds for news aggregation and to display live posts from Facebook and Instagram. Additionally, the software supports specific German public broadcasting news elements from ARD, such as Tagesschau, ARD-Regional, and Sportschau, often requiring an internet connection for these features.
The company states that DSSHOW's installation process is straightforward, similar to installing common software applications, and it is designed for integration into existing systems. The software also offers compatibility with Microsoft Office products like Excel and PowerPoint, facilitating the transfer of created graphics and data for display.
According to SignApp, the software can present a wide array of content formats including JPG images, videos, Excel spreadsheets, and web content. Businesses can customize the displayed information to suit their audience. The company also offers consultation services for effective visual communication strategies using digital screens.
